月亮链 月亮链
Ctrl+D收藏月亮链
首页 > USDC > 正文

VEN:由 MDUKEY 加密方式引申开:关于区块链中常见的非对称加密算法_venanetwor

作者:

时间:1900/1/1 0:00:00

一、背景:

一直以来,用户隐私数据的安全都是MDUKEY的重中之重。作为最优先级的事项,MDUKEY存储服务使用代理重加密、多层加密(应用层、网关层、文件系统层)等技术保护用户隐私数据,并对用户数据数据进行最小拆分,分布式存储,减少数据大面积泄露的风险,同时保证服务的高可用性。

而在数据安全的基础上,MDUKEY使用对称加密与非对称加密技术结合的加密方式,以及专业的加解密硬件,提高加解密的速率,保证服务的高吞吐量。

其中,非对称加密作为区块链领域中的基石,虽然被很多人听说过,但并不被具体了解。

因此,本文将从加密方式引申开,深入浅出介绍关于非对称加密算法中的“签名与加密”。

Access Protocol推出NFT工具Sketch:金色财经报道,基于Solana(SOL)的web3平台Access Protocol(ACS)推出了Sketch,这是一种NFT发行和无代码铸造工具。Access协议表示,使用Sketch的创作者将能够获得其NFT系列的尖端技术,从而使他们能够以更低的价格铸造数字资产。此外,该工具还允许他们同时铸造多个NFT。虽然Sketch仍处于测试模式,但这家加密内容货币化公司指出,想要加入该平台的新创作者表现出了浓厚的兴趣。[2023/8/13 16:23:31]

二、什么是非对称加密?

非对称加密,也称为公开密钥加密,是密码学的一种算法。它需要两个密钥,一个是公开密钥,另一个是私有密钥。顾名思义,公钥可以任意对外发布;而私钥必须由用户自行严格秘密保管,绝不透过任何途径向任何人提供,也不会透露给要通信的另一方。

新加坡金管局:同意与英国在加密资产和稳定币监管领域优先合作:11月25日消息,新加坡金融管理局和英国财政部今日发布联合文告,同意要在加密资产等方面优先进一步合作,两国都分享了对市场发展、机会、趋势以及对加密资产行业的长期预期的最新评估,金融稳定、监管套利(regulatory arbitrage)有关的风险和挑战,以及在加强消费者保护条例和稳定币监管方面的进展,已就支持数字资产生态系统安全发展的必要性达成了强烈共识,同时确保数码资产带来的风险得到持续管理。(联合早报)[2022/11/25 20:45:58]

非对称加密算法实现机密信息交换的基本过程是:甲方生成一对密钥并将公钥公开,需要向甲方发送信息的其他角色(乙方)使用该密钥(甲方的公钥)对机密信息进行加密后再发送给甲方;甲方再用自己私钥对加密后的信息进行解密。甲方想要回复乙方时正好相反,使用乙方的公钥对数据进行加密,同理,乙方使用自己的私钥来进行解密。

加密投资基金SevenX Ventures完成第三期基金首次募集,共募集8000万美元:9月14日消息,加密投资基金 SevenX Ventures 宣布完成第三期基金首次募集,共募集 8000 万美元。据悉,SevenX Ventures 第三期基金总规模 1 亿美元,将在 10 月底前完成募集。本期基金的资金主要来自于一二期基金 LP 的持续追投,以及亚洲头部互联网创业者的家族办公室。

SevenX Ventures 第三期基金将持续其一贯的精品基金策略,联接东西方创业者和生态,并提供如经济体系设计等重点投后服务。SevenX Ventures 第三期基金会将其 60% 的资金用于投资以数据层为主的中间件与基础设施协议,40% 的资金用于投资以亚洲应用开发者为核心的去中心化应用,涵盖游戏、金融、内容与社交等新商业模式探索。[2022/9/14 13:29:28]

非对称加密具有两个重要的性质:

SMBC宣布推出web3、NFT、托管计划:金色财经报道,三井住友金融集团(SMBC)宣布计划与日本web3初创公司HashPort合作,围绕Web3和NFT开发生态系统,包括在日本推广Web3。他们还计划在监护权方面合作。两家机构将成立代币商业实验室,合作研究和示范,推广代币业务。之后,三井住友银行计划发展自己的代币业务,双方将咨询计划发行代币的企业,例如NFT。(ledgerinsights)[2022/7/22 2:31:59]

2.1加密的双向性

加密具有双向性,即公钥和私钥中的任一个均可用作加密,此时另一个则用作解密。

使用其中一个密钥把明文加密后所得的密文,只能用相对应的另一个密钥才能解密得到原本的明文,甚至连最初用来加密的密钥也不能用作解密,这是非对称加密最重要的性质或者说特点。

2.2公钥无法推导出私钥

必须确保使用公钥无法推导出私钥,至少妄想使用公钥推导私钥必须在计算上是不可行的,否则安全性将不复存在。

虽然两个密钥在数学上相关,但如果知道了公钥,并不能凭此计算出私钥;因此公钥可以公开,任意向外发布;而私钥不公开,绝不透过任何途径向任何人提供。

三、常见的非对称加密算法:

目前常见的非对称加密有RSA算法、Elgamal算法和椭圆曲线数字签名算法,其中椭圆曲线数字签名算法是区块链中应用最多的方法。

3.1RSA算法

RSA是被研究得最广泛的公钥算法,从提出到现在已有四十年的历史,经历了各种攻击考验。RSA的安全性主要依赖大数分解,优势是秘钥长度可以增加到任意长度。RSA运算方式造成了签名内容如果较短,会被很容易修改为攻击者想要的内容,所以一般还需要将签名内容进行一次哈希运算,并填充至和私钥差不多的长度。此外,随着计算能力的增长,为防止被破解,秘钥长度也需要不断增长,目前认为安全的秘钥长度是2048bit。同时RSA的私钥生成需要两个质数的组合,因此寻找更长私钥的计算速度也更慢。

3.2Elgamal算法

Elgamal由TaherElgamal于1985年发明,其基础是DiffieˉHellman密钥交换算法,后者使通信双方能通过公开通信来推导出只有他们知道的秘密密钥值。

DiffieˉHellman是WhitfieldDiffie和MartinHellman于1976年发明的,被视为第一种非对称加密算法,DiffieˉHellman与RSA的不同之处在于,DiffieˉHellman不是加密算法,它只是生成可用作对称密钥的秘密数值。

在DiffieˉHellman密钥交换过程中,发送方和接收方分别生成一个秘密的随机数,并根据随机数推导出公开值,然后,双方再交换公开值。DiffieˉHellman算法的基础是具备生成共享密钥的能力。只要交换了公开值,双方就能使用自己的私有数和对方的公开值来生成对称密钥,称为共享密钥。对双方来说,该对称密钥是相同的,可以用于使用对称加密算法加密数据。

3.3椭圆曲线数字签名算法

椭圆曲线算法是利用在有限域上的椭圆曲线的离散对数问题来加密或签名的。椭圆曲线的秘钥和RSA不同,有效范围会受椭圆曲线参数的限制,因此不能像RSA一样可以通过增加私钥长度来提高安全性,对于安全性不够的曲线,必须修改椭圆曲线的参数,不如RSA灵活。

和RSA算法比,椭圆曲线的优势在于:私钥可以选取有效范围内的任意数,私钥的生成速度远快于RSA算法的私钥。最重要的是相同秘钥长度的椭圆曲线安全性能高很多,因此达到相同安全等级需要的椭圆曲线秘钥的长度远小于RSA秘钥的长度,因此占用的存储空间相对较小,对于存储比较受限的区块链来说,椭圆曲线更适用。

标签:VENFFIMANNFTvenanetworYFFII FinanceMAN价格NFTART币

USDC热门资讯
比特币:女演员迈西·威廉姆斯(Maisie Williams)成为最新的比特币人吗?_NFT

“加入免费的民间,长比特币,”Blockfolio对《权力的游戏》女星说。英国女演员MaisieWilliams以在HBO系列《权力的游戏》中扮演AryaStark的角色而闻名,她可能会加入比特.

1900/1/1 0:00:00
比特币:2100万枚BTC全部开采完,比特币矿业生态和网络会发生什么?_莱特币和比特币的关系

众所周知,比特币区块链在初始设计时是按照可控的供应原则设计的,总量上限为2100万枚。这意味着每年只能开采固定数量的新比特币,一旦全部开采完成,就不会有新的比特币进入流通.

1900/1/1 0:00:00
UDO:关于WBF上线ROCC的公告_OCC

尊敬的用户:ROCC将在WBF创新区上线ROCC/USDT交易对,具体时间安排如下:充币时间:2020-11-1912:00交易时间:2020-11-2016:00提币时间:2020-11-19.

1900/1/1 0:00:00
AXI:觅新 | Axie Infinity火了 NFT游戏会成为热点吗?_NFI

《觅新》是金色财经推出的一档区块链项目观察类项目,覆盖行业各领域项目发展情况,具体设计到项目概况、技术进展、募资情况等,力图为您呈现一线重点、热门新潮的项目合辑.

1900/1/1 0:00:00
数字资产:加密数据提供商 Lukka 与 IHS Markit 合作为金融业提供加密资产数据_ELD

链闻消息,总部位于纽约的加密数据提供商Lukka宣布市场咨询公司IHSMarkit建立合作关系,以重新分配其机构级区块链和数字资产数据产品.

1900/1/1 0:00:00
TER:币汐柔:11.18比特币以太坊投资技巧之相对强弱指标RSI分享_ORDI

币汐柔:11.18比特币以太坊投资技巧之相对强弱指标RSI分享RSI是指固定期间内价格上涨总幅度平均数占总幅度平均值的比例,从而探测出市场买、卖的意向和实力,进而做出未来市场的走势判断.

1900/1/1 0:00:00